    Using your tablet - 15 Status and notification area Status and notification icons are shown at the top of the screen. The top-right corner displays status information such as the battery status, and connectivity. The top-left corner displays time and event notifications, such as new message alerts.

    Using your tablet - 17 Split-screen mode If you are using a compatible app (not from the Home screen), tap and hold the Overview icon to enter split-screen mode. The app that is open will move to the left (or top) of the screen and the Overview of recently opened apps will open on the other side.

    46 - Advanced settings Updating your tablet's operating system Your tablet can download and install system updates, adding support for new devices or expanding software options. To check for operating system, or 'firmware', updates, open Settings > System > About tablet > System updates > CHECK NOW.
